Pulmonary endometriosis: treatment with danazol

Pulmonary endometriosis is a rare clinical problem. There is limited information available regarding management of this disorder. Four cases of successful treatment with danazol have been reported. This is a report of a woman with catamenial hemoptysis who responded successfully to danazol therapy; however, hemoptysis resumed after cessation of therapy. The patient was subsequently treated successfully with a total abdominal hysterectomy and bilateral oophorectomy.
